Khanbi Chak

Khanbi Chak is a village located in Pingla subdivision of Paschim Medinipur district in West Bengal, India. Midnapur and Pingla are the district & sub-district headquarters of Khanbi Chak village respectively. As per 2009 stats, Maligram is the gram panchayat of Khanbi Chak village.

About Khanbi Chak

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Khanbi Chak is 342675. The village spans a total geographical area of 99 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 721140. Kharagpur is nearest town to Khanbi Chak village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 52km away.

Population of Khanbi Chak

According to the 2011 Census, Khanbi Chak has a total population of about 766, with approximately 387 males and 379 females. The sex ratio is around 979 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 82 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 59 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 6. The overall literacy rate is approximately 81.98%, with male literacy at about 86.56% and female literacy near 77.31%. There are around 196 households in the village. Connectivity of Khanbi Chak

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Khanbi Chak. As per the 2011 stats, Khanbi Chak had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
